Personal Loan Sent to the Wrong Account: Contain and Trace It

Report a wrong-account disbursement immediately, preserve the beneficiary evidence, stop repayment-record confusion, and trace the transfer in writing.

Nikhil VermaUpdated: August 7, 2026Sources checked: August 3, 2026

Report the mismatch immediately through the lender’s official channel. State the sanctioned borrower account, the account shown in the disbursement record, the amount, date and transaction reference. Ask the lender to freeze further processing where possible, trace the transfer and confirm how repayment reporting will be protected while the error is investigated.

Preserve the disbursement trail

  • Sanction letter, KFS and signed agreement.
  • The bank account you authorised for receipt.
  • Disbursement SMS, email, statement and transaction reference.
  • Any screen or form that showed the beneficiary account before acceptance.
  • Your complaint number, time, channel and staff response.

Do not send OTPs, PINs or remote-access permissions to a person claiming they can reverse the loan. Use only the lender’s verified app, website, branch or published grievance contact.

Identify what kind of error occurred

A typo in the borrower account, a lender-side beneficiary substitution, a disbursement to an end-beneficiary for a documented specific purpose, and an unknown third-party transfer are different cases. Digital-lending rules generally require disbursement to the borrower’s bank account, with limited exceptions such as a specific end-use paid directly to the end-beneficiary. Ask the lender to identify the exception and documentary basis if it claims one.

Keep repayment and credit reporting separate from recovery

Do not assume that an incorrect destination automatically cancels the loan contract or future reporting. Ask in writing whether an EMI mandate is active, when the first payment is due, and what temporary protection will be applied to late-payment or credit-bureau reporting while the complaint is unresolved. Do not sign a fresh loan or “replacement” agreement unless the old exposure and wrong transfer are clearly accounted for.

Use a precise written remedy

Request: confirmation of the destination account, a trace or recall attempt, restoration or correct disbursement, a corrected ledger, protection from charges caused by the error, and a written timeline. If money reached an account you control but did not expect, do not move or spend it until the lender gives written instructions.

Escalate safely

Escalate to the regulated entity’s grievance officer with all evidence. Digital-lending rules keep responsibility with the regulated lender even where a lending service provider or app was involved. If the regulated entity does not resolve an eligible complaint through its process, RBI CMS may be available after the required waiting/response stage.

Frequently Asked Questions

What should I do first if a personal loan went to the wrong account?
Contact the lender through an official channel immediately, identify the incorrect and intended account details, request containment or recall where possible, and obtain a complaint reference number.
